One year ago we bought a place in Coats, NC with two large ponds, being inhibit with a muted swan couple. We were told that every year their offspring disappear very early on and none of them ever made it. This year we decided to capture one, and he is now six weeks old and as large as a duck. When do you think will be the right time to let him back to his parents? We have observed large fish, turtles, blue heron and hawks at our place and therefore worried about those predators.
